June 9th, 2011, 15:00 UTC in #ubuntu-meeting.


Action Items from last meeting

  • NCommander to get Documentation spec approved

Standing Items

Meeting Outcome

[15:58] <NCommander> #startmeeting
[15:58] <MootBot> Meeting started at 09:58. The chair is NCommander.
[15:59] <davidm> G'day NCommander
[15:59]  * NCommander sleeply waves
[15:59] <NCommander> [topic] Action Item Review
[15:59] <NCommander> [link] https://wiki.ubuntu.com/MobileTeam/Meeting/2011/20110526https://wiki.ubuntu.com/MobileTeam/Meeting/2011/20110526
[15:59] <NCommander> er, none
[16:00] <NCommander> [topic] Standing Items
[16:00] <NCommander> [link] http://people.canonical.com/~platform/workitems/oneiric/ubuntu-armel.html
[16:00] <NCommander> I just realized I posted the wrong link
[16:00] <NCommander> [link] https://wiki.ubuntu.com/MobileTeam/Meeting/2011/20110623
[16:01] <NCommander> [topic] NCommander to get Documentation spec approved
[16:01] <NCommander> c/o
[16:01] <NCommander> [topic] http://people.canonical.com/~platform/workitems/oneiric/ubuntu-armel.html
[16:01] <NCommander> [topic] http://people.canonical.com/~platform/workitems/oneiric/ubuntu-armel-oneiric-alpha-2.html
[16:02] <ogra> we look bad ...
[16:02] <ogra> but with dublin ahead that should not matter
[16:02] <NCommander> ++
[16:03] <NCommander> anything else or can I move on?
[16:03] <ogra> move
[16:03] <NCommander> [topic] ARM Server Status (NCommander, Daviey)
[16:04] <NCommander> Slow week. Did some work creating udebs, and determined my panda was fried.
[16:04] <ogra> the existing PXE code is uploaded though
[16:04] <NCommander> \o/
[16:05] <ogra> havent tested how complete it is yet
[16:05] <NCommander> we've got the sprint, we'll catch up there
[16:05] <NCommander> [topic] Kernel Status (cooloney, rsalveti, ppisati)
[16:05] <ogra> yep
[16:05] <ppisati> nothing exciting: usual tons of cve fixes
[16:05] <ogra> any news regarding the usb issue ?
[16:05] <ppisati> and...
[16:05] <ppisati> the usb issue has been fixed & committed :)
[16:06] <ogra> \o/
[16:06] <GrueMaster> woot
[16:06] <ppisati> yep
[16:06] <NCommander> yay
[16:06] <ppisati> btw i'm bit low on stuff, so if you have any outstading issue
[16:06] <ppisati> feel free to throw it to me
[16:06] <ogra> we'll get you stuff next week, dont worry
[16:07] <ppisati> BTW, bring some otg stuff to dublin since it seems i can't make it work
[16:07]  * NCommander throws a trout at ppisati 
[16:07] <ppisati> :)
[16:07] <ogra> sprints are good for collecting bugs
[16:07] <GrueMaster> Ohhh yeaaa.
[16:07] <ppisati> you can move from my pov
[16:07] <ppisati> ah no
[16:07] <ppisati> wait
[16:07] <ppisati> tegra2?
[16:07] <GrueMaster> ppisati: I'll bring you an OTG cable.
[16:08] <ppisati> GrueMaster: i've all kinds of otg cables but it seems it doesn't make any difference for my xm
[16:08] <ppisati> GrueMaster: anyway, bring it, thanks
[16:08] <NCommander> [topic] ARM Porting/FTBFS status (NCommander, janimo)
[16:08] <NCommander> telepathy-glib has kicked out asses
[16:08]  * ogra looks at infinity 
[16:09] <ogra> your sync ftbfs
[16:09] <ogra> sadly empathy gets uninstallable through that
[16:09] <ogra> so we dont get images
[16:10] <NCommander> anything else?
[16:10]  * ogra would like to have a recent image before the sprint ... 
[16:10] <davidm> Yes that would be nice
[16:10] <ogra> should we drop ampathy for now ?
[16:10] <ogra> *empathy
[16:10] <davidm> Yes if need be
[16:11] <NCommander> ++
[16:11] <ogra> i'm not sure if there is more in the desktop seed
[16:11] <davidm> I really don't want to block on that
[16:11] <ogra> more depending on telepathy-glib i mean
[16:11] <infinity> Err, oh.  Right.  Meeting.
[16:11] <infinity> NCommander: tp-glib is suffering from "lp-buildd is broken" issues.
[16:12] <infinity> ogra: No need to drop empathy, I'll just bump the test timeout in tp-glib to something stupidly high to work around twistd.
[16:12] <NCommander> ugh
[16:12]  * infinity will throw a test upload at his PPA right now and see if it sticks.
[16:12] <ogra> infinity, ok, if we dont have a binary by tomorrow evening i'll drop it though
[16:12] <infinity> ogra: *nod*
[16:13] <ogra> so we have a chance to get an image over the weekend
[16:13] <infinity> ogra: If you do, file a bug against soyuz, it's not actually a tp-glib issue.
[16:14] <ogra> well, thats only temporary indeed, we can corner StevenK in dublin to fix it ;)
[16:14]  * NCommander packs duct tape and a staple gun
[16:14] <NCommander> k
[16:14] <NCommander> can we ove?
[16:14] <ogra> nothing else from me
[16:14] <ogra> (and partially also already the image topic :) )
[16:15] <NCommander> [topic] ARM Image Status (ogra, NCommander)
[16:15]  * GrueMaster hasn't ove'd in years
[16:15] <ogra> GrueMaster, oh ? why not ?
[16:15] <ogra> well ... image status, headles builds fine, i havent tested a single one since a while though
[16:16] <ogra> desktop doesnt ... see above :)
[16:16] <NCommander> is there anything else?
[16:16] <GrueMaster> Tested headless omap4 on Tuesday.  Still works.
[16:16]  * NCommander doesn't have anything to add
[16:16] <ogra> great
[16:16] <GrueMaster> Good progress on netboot.
[16:16] <ogra> jasper will need preseed file support for server preinstalled
[16:16] <ogra> we need to discuss where to put that file in dublin
[16:17] <ogra> since unlike in d-i images it will persist on the FS
[16:17] <NCommander> ogra: /var/cache/installer/preseed?
[16:17] <ogra> something like that
[16:17] <NCommander> oro something like that
[16:18] <ogra> yeah
[16:18] <NCommander> anything else?
[16:18] <ogra> the coding will be trivial, but i somehow cant make up my mind about the file :)
[16:18] <ogra> nothing else here
[16:18] <NCommander> [topic] QA Status (GrueMaster)
[16:18] <GrueMaster> Oh, that's me.
[16:19] <GrueMaster> I have my relay now fully operational and online.  I can remotely control 2 pandas atm (limited to pandas on hand).
[16:19] <ogra> you should patent that and sell it to zoos ;)
[16:19] <GrueMaster> Work progressing on ramping up jenkins automation environment.  Lots of questions for the QA guys next week.
[16:20] <GrueMaster> filesystem benchmark testing is very slow & manual.  Each run takes 84 hours and then I have to reformat & restore the rootfs.
[16:21] <ogra> how do you benchmark exactly ?
[16:21] <GrueMaster> I'm using the phoronix filesystem benchmarks.
[16:21] <ogra> i think actually just producing different bootcharts for different filesystems should already show some markers
[16:21] <GrueMaster> All the fs benchmarking tools in one convenient package.
[16:22] <GrueMaster> Not reliable.
[16:22] <ogra> reliable for boot time measuring
[16:22] <ogra> indeed not for a full filesystem benchmark
[16:22] <GrueMaster> filesystem testing is more than just booting.
[16:23] <ogra> i didnt say it isnt :)
[16:23] <GrueMaster> And my task is to benchmark filesystems.  This seemed the best way.
[16:23] <ogra> but getting a bootchart is a matter of seconds
[16:23] <NCommander> ogra: but bootchart is mostly read and sequencish IO
[16:23] <ogra> sure
[16:23] <NCommander> not nightmarish abuse that phoronix does
[16:23] <GrueMaster> exactly.
[16:23] <ogra> its only one aspect
[16:24] <ogra> but low hanging fruit wrt data gathering
[16:24] <NCommander> invalid datat though.
[16:24] <ogra> no
[16:24] <NCommander> would give us skrewed results
[16:24] <GrueMaster> Our boot performance isn't the issue (actually boot time is very impressive).
[16:24] <infinity> bootcharting (especially with intelligent readahead stuff in play) isn't testing your filesystem at all, just the speed of your disk.
[16:24] <ogra> would give us tendency about reading on different filesystems while the full suite runs
[16:24] <infinity> Since most boot tricks are designed to work AROUND the filesystem. :P
[16:24] <GrueMaster> My panda boots nearly at the same speed as my netbook with SSD.
[16:25] <ogra> from power on to desktop ?
[16:25] <GrueMaster> ogra: You would be looking at a few milliseconds in differences.
[16:25] <GrueMaster> yes.
[16:25] <infinity> And yeah, my Panda boots impressively quickly.
[16:25] <infinity> And then takes 20 minutes to load Firefox while I go for lunch.
[16:25] <ogra> intresting, your netbook must have a slow bios :)
[16:25] <GrueMaster> The u-boot delay is close to the bios init time on my netbook.
[16:25] <ogra> infinity, far from whats possible
[16:25]  * rsalveti waves
[16:26] <ogra> u-boot steals massive amounts of time
[16:26] <rsalveti> should we change u-boot count time for 1, 2 seconds?
[16:26] <GrueMaster> 4 seconds of u-boot countdown.
[16:26] <GrueMaster> currently
[16:26] <GrueMaster> 10 on beagle.
[16:26] <ogra> plus about 10-12 for loading initrd and kernel
[16:27] <rsalveti> GrueMaster: I believe 10 will be fixed in next u-boot upload
[16:27] <GrueMaster> Really?
[16:27] <rsalveti> that should be coming today or tomorrow
[16:27] <rsalveti> nops, it's fast now
[16:27] <rsalveti> 2, 3 secs to load
[16:27] <rsalveti> at least on panda/beagle
[16:27] <rsalveti> because of the multi block read
[16:27] <ogra> oh, then it improved
[16:27] <GrueMaster> ogra: Not sure why you are seeing such slow kernel & initrd load times.  Mine is maybe .5 seconds.
[16:28] <rsalveti> just firefox that's a pita atm
[16:28] <rsalveti> I can make a fresh coffee when I decided to start it
[16:28] <GrueMaster> heh
[16:28] <ogra> GrueMaster, from end of countdown to the "ucompressing kernel" message its .5s ?
[16:29] <GrueMaster> roughly for each, yes.
[16:29] <ogra> i'm surely not seeing such times
[16:29] <infinity> rsalveti: Firefox may as well be the "vicious filesystem test" we're looking for, once it's been used a bit.  Cause loading the profile and parsing history, etc, is just evil on a randomly-accessed/abused SD.
[16:29] <GrueMaster> I'll try to time it with a stopwatch.
[16:29] <ogra> though i havent tried oeniric on my panda yet
[16:30] <rsalveti> infinity: yeah, did you try to profile it already?
[16:30] <GrueMaster> That was true even with natty beta+
[16:30] <ogra> will pull a headless image, thats actually something i want to see
[16:30] <infinity> rsalveti: No, I just plugged in an external hard drive, thus preventing my urge to launch my Panda out the window.
[16:30] <rsalveti> :-)
[16:30] <GrueMaster> headless & netbook should have the same start times prior to mounting rootfs and running init from there.
[16:30]  * ogra just uses chromium :)
[16:31] <NCommander> anything els or can I move on?
[16:31] <GrueMaster> chromium is not on the image.  invalid test procedure.
[16:31] <GrueMaster> move.
[16:31] <ogra> yeah
[16:32] <ogra> well, surely not invalid :)
[16:32] <NCommander> [topic] AOB
[16:32] <GrueMaster> for filesystem abuse?  yes it is if it doesn't do the same thrashing.
[16:32]  * ogra is pretty sure fta likes to get arm bugs from actual users :)
[16:33] <ogra> GrueMaster, no, for having a usable browser :)
[16:33] <infinity> (The real fun is when you start swapping to a swap file on the SD, and realise that you probably would have rather just had the OOM killer pick something at random to slaughter than put up with swapping to the same SD you're trying to randomly read/write to)
[16:33] <ogra> not for FS abuse testing
[16:33] <NCommander> if nothing else will close the meeting out
[16:33] <NCommander> 3
[16:33] <NCommander> 2
[16:33] <davidm> Folks for the ARM Server Project test against USB HD
[16:33] <ogra> infinity, well, tell that to the guy with the 200 page writer document open he just wrote :)
[16:34] <davidm> not SD card time please
[16:34] <infinity> davidm: Yeah, and I'm VERY pleased with the Panda with a USB HDD.
[16:34] <NCommander> thanks davidm
[16:34] <ogra> i rarther wait 20min for my system to return than having OOM kick in in such a case
[16:34] <GrueMaster> davidm: planned on it.
[16:34] <davidm> I do want to figure out the SD card issues but that may be a hardware issue
[16:34] <davidm> and un fixable by us
[16:34] <NCommander> ogra: you can force that by smacking with knobs with sysctl)
[16:35] <davidm> I'm looking forward to next week
[16:35] <ogra> NCommander, i can also have a swapfile and swppiness set to 1
[16:35] <GrueMaster> davidm: The idea behind the filesystem benchmarking & improvement was doing the best with what we have.
[16:35] <NCommander> anyway, can I close the meeting now?
[16:35] <ogra> which gets me the overflow memory on disk
[16:35] <NCommander> guess not
[16:35] <GrueMaster> NCommander: Wait 5.
[16:35] <ogra> instead of stealoing from another app
[16:35] <ogra> close :)
[16:36] <davidm> Close
[16:36]  * ogra doesnt have anything
[16:36] <GrueMaster> done
[16:36] <infinity> davidm: And I concur.  I'm loooking forward to seeing everyone again.  Face-time makes a huge difference sometimes.
[16:36] <NCommander> #endmeeting

Action Items

  • None

